Unless your bird is going through a moult, he should not be able to gain hight from having the wings clipped already. Maybe the breeder only did a light clip, removing one or two feathers.

If he will take food from your hand, you could try offering food when out of the cage so it encourages him to be with you. Use something he likes and only give it to him from your hand, not at meal times etc. So he will associate the yummy treat and being with you as a good thing.
